MGSC 607 Corporate Social Responsibility in Supply Chain Management (1 credit)

Offered by: Management (Desautels Faculty of Management)

Administered by: Graduate Studies

Overview

Management Science : Introduction to the basic theories and development on business ethics and corporate social responsibility (CSR).

Terms: Summer 2025

Instructors: There are no professors associated with this course for the 2024-2025 academic year.

  • Restriction: Only open to students in the Master of Management in Manufacturing Management; Non-Thesis program.

  • **Due to the intensive nature of this course, the standard add/drop and withdrawal deadlines do not apply. Add/drop is the second lecture day and withdrawal is the third lecture day.

  • **This course will be held on June 4, 5, 25, 26 and there will be a paper due on July 17, 2021.
